GPS Tracking Prevents Equipment Theft

Beyond perimeter lighting and cameras, GPS tracking devices offer a powerful layer of protection by letting you monitor your equipment’s location in real time. You can attach these devices to heavy machinery, generators, and valuable tools, creating a digital record of where everything is at any moment.
Real time geofencing works by establishing virtual boundaries around your jobsite. If equipment leaves the designated area, you’ll receive an immediate alert. This feature proves especially useful for preventing theft during off-hours when supervision is minimal.
Additionally, GPS systems provide maintenance alerts that notify you when equipment requires servicing. This keeps your tools in better condition and helps you track usage patterns. Combined with your other security measures, GPS tracking greatly reduces the likelihood of losing expensive equipment to theft.

Access Control: Restrict Who Can Move Equipment
Controlling who can access and operate equipment on your jobsite isn’t just a security measure—it’s a fundamental way to prevent theft and unauthorized movement of valuable machinery. Implement credential verification systems, like ID badges or biometric scanning, to track exactly who enters your site and handles equipment. These systems create accountability, making it harder for thieves to operate undetected. Establish movement zoning by designating specific areas where equipment can be relocated, requiring authorization for any transfers outside these zones. When operators need clearance to move machinery, you’ll immediately notice suspicious activity. Combine credential verification with GPS tracking so you know both who moved equipment and where it went. This layered approach markedly deters theft while maintaining efficient jobsite operations.

Marking Tools to Prevent Theft and Enable Recovery
While end-of-shift audits help you catch theft quickly, marking your tools makes them harder to steal in the first place and easier to recover if they do disappear. Owner engraving involves etching your company name or initials directly onto tools, creating a permanent identifier that thieves find difficult to remove. You can also assign serialized identifiers through tagging systems like barcodes or QR codes, which link each tool to your inventory database. These marking methods deter opportunistic theft because stolen tools become traceable and less valuable to resell. If theft does occur, marked equipment’s identification markedly increases recovery chances. Implement a systematic marking program for all high-value items, ensuring consistent documentation that supports both prevention and potential retrieval efforts.

Can Geofencing Alerts Prevent Theft Before Equipment Actually Leaves the Site?
Yes, geofencing alerts can help prevent theft by notifying you when equipment leaves designated zones. However, I’d caution that geofence latency and boundary spoofing can create vulnerabilities, so they’re most effective combined with GPS tracking and physical security measures.
How Should Smaller Tools Be Organized in Secured Containers for Quick Audits?
I’d organize your smaller tools using color coded cases for quick visual identification and sequential inventory numbering. This lets you audit faster—you’ll spot missing items instantly without opening every container.
